Why Switch to an RPG-Style Perspective?

The vanilla Minecraft third-person mode simply locks the camera behind your character, offering limited flexibility when trying to inspect your surroundings or engage in combat. In contrast, this add-on introduces true orbit control. By holding the right mouse button, you can rotate the camera freely around your avatar without changing the direction your character is facing. This distinction is crucial for role-playing enthusiasts who want to admire their custom armor sets or survey a battlefield while keeping their character ready to move.

One of the most intelligent features of this system is how it handles block interaction. When your mouse cursor is visible during orbit control, clicking will place blocks as expected. However, once you move the mouse far enough to fade the cursor, you enter pure camera manipulation mode. Releasing the right-click button ensures no accidental blocks are placed, allowing for seamless transitions between building and observing. Mastering the New Control Scheme

Adapting to this new perspective requires understanding the updated input logic. The default method to zoom in and out involves holding the Left Alt key while scrolling your mouse wheel, providing smooth distance adjustments. You might notice duplicated keybinds for strafing, such as Q and E. Do not be confused; the mod intelligently switches contexts. When you are in the specialized third-person mode, the game utilizes the RPG-specific keybinds. The moment you switch back to first-person vision, vanilla controls resume immediately.

Furthermore, this system grants you the ability to break or place blocks without directly looking at them, provided your mouse is free. You can still interact with complex entities like furnaces, chests, and crafting tables without breaking immersion. All these inputs are fully customizable within the settings menu under "RPG Camera & Controls," ensuring that every player can tailor the experience to their specific playstyle.

Many players wonder how to install such a transformative tool without compromising their existing modpacks. Fortunately, because this add-on focuses primarily on client-side rendering and input handling, it rarely conflicts with server-side plugins or other gameplay modifications. This compatibility makes it a safe addition to almost any multiplayer environment, provided the server allows client-side mods that do not offer unfair advantages.
